Money Bubble - Seniors Event

During the Money Bubble of the Seniors event, there were no all-in-and-call situations until Hand #9, when the short stack doubled up with deuces against ace-queen.

In Hand #10, two out of four tables had all-in-and-call situations, but they had to wait to resolve their hands because one of the other two tables had a player shove on the river, and his opponent tanked for a long time.

Eventually, that player folded, and then the short stacks at the other two tables both doubled up. (Pocket fives held against ace-jack, and pocket nines held against king-nine.)

The next all-in-and-call situation came in Hand #12, when pocket aces held up against pocket fours.

The Money Bubble continues …

With 31 players remaining from a field of 238, the average chip stack is around 154,000 (26 big blinds). The field is on the Money Bubble, with a min-cash of $550 for the final 30 players.
